Breaking Down the Features of Si-Tex SDD-110 Seawater Depth Indicator

Specifications

  • The Si-Tex SDD-110 Seawater Depth Indicator operates on a working frequency of 120kHz. This frequency helps to avoid interference with other onboard echosounders, a common issue in crowded waterways.
  • The unit measures only 4.3″ X 4.3″ X 3.5″, making it incredibly compact and easy to mount in tight spaces. Its small footprint is a significant advantage for smaller boats with limited dashboard or console space.
  • It uses Digital Signal Processing (DSP) technology to deliver accurate digital depth readings. This technology ensures reliable readings even in challenging conditions such as murky water or strong currents.
  • The depth range is from 1.5′ to 1375′, catering to a wide range of boating activities, from shallow inshore fishing to deeper offshore navigation. This wide range makes it versatile for different types of water environments.
  • The display is a large four-digit LCD with five levels of backlighting for optimum visibility. The adjustable backlighting ensures that the display is readable in all ambient light conditions, from bright sunlight to complete darkness.
  • The unit uses an inexpensive flush-mount 2″ thru-hull transducer with a 38-degree beam angle. This transducer design allows for easy installation and proper beam orientation on most hulls without the need for a fairing block.
  • The SDD-110 is a one-piece system, meaning no separate black box is required. This simplifies installation and reduces clutter, which is especially beneficial in smaller vessels.

Who Should Buy Si-Tex SDD-110 Seawater Depth Indicator?

The Si-Tex SDD-110 Seawater Depth Indicator is perfect for recreational boaters, anglers, and sailors who need a simple and reliable depth sounder without the complexity of networked systems. It’s also ideal for smaller vessels where space is at a premium. Pro anglers using larger networked systems as a primary, might also consider it as an excellent and cost-effective backup.

Those who need advanced features such as chartplotting integration, fishfinding capabilities, or customizable alarms might want to consider a more advanced (and expensive) system. Also, owners of larger vessels needing advanced navigational aids should look elsewhere.

A must-have accessory would be a good quality marine-grade power cable and connectors. Consider using a dedicated fuse to protect the unit from power surges.
